CVE-2012-2583 describes a Cross-site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in version 1.42 of the Mini Mail Dashboard Widget plugin for WordPress, allowing attackers to inject malicious web scripts through email bodies. This vulnerability has a CVSS score of 4.3, indicating medium attack complexity and requiring user interaction, with potential impact limited to integrity. While not actively exploited in the wild or on the CISA KEV catalog, public exploit code exists on ExploitDB, though there is minimal community discussion or media coverage surrounding this CVE.
